Zen Technologies is navigating a complex landscape characterized by a strong order pipeline and a commitment to indigenous technology, which positions it favorably for future growth. Management's bullish outlook is supported by anticipated improvements in execution and significant order inflows, particularly in the defense simulation and anti-drone sectors. Despite recent margin pressures due to execution delays and increased costs, the company's strategic focus on high-yield, IP-led platforms and expansion into international markets, especially the U.S., underpins Vista's revenue growth expectations. The defense sector's expansion, driven by geopolitical tensions and government spending, further enhances Zen's market position. However, execution risks and the lumpy nature of government contracts remain critical watchpoints. Over the next 12-24 months, Zen is expected to leverage its robust order book and product innovations to drive revenue growth, with a target price reflecting a 23.81% upside. Key opportunities include scaling the Vector Technics business and capturing market share in the U.S. simulator market, while headwinds include potential delays in drone procurement and foreign currency exposure

Zen Technologies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the design, development, manufacture, and sale of training simulators in India and internationally. The company provides anti-drone systems; training and simulation live ranges, comprising smart and multi-functional target systems, tank targets, master control station for live-firing ranges, air-to-ground firing range scoring system, containerized tubular and indoor shooting range, shoot house for live and simulated indoor tactical training, special purpose adapter for hand guns, cornershot weapon system, tank zeroing system, and containerized small arms firing range; armour combat training, indoor tracking, hand grenade simulator, and tactical engagement simulation systems; advanced weapon, medium machine gun, automatic grenade launcher, mortar integrated and carrier mortar tracked integrated, anti-tank guided missile, combat and infantry weapons training, artillery forward observers, integrated air defence, UAV mission, rotary wing, infantry combat vehicle driving, crew gunnery, gunnery, driving, BMP II integrated missile, driving training, automated driving, and bus and tatra driving simulators; and driving aptitude testing system. It serves police, paramilitary, armed, and security forces; government departments comprising transport, mining, and infrastructure; and the civilian markets. Zen Technologies Limited was incorporated in 1993 and is headquartered in Hyderabad, India.
